battery formation time Explanation: Battery formation is the process of performing the initial charge/discharge operation on the battery cell. During this stage, special electrochemical solid electrolyte interphase (SEI) will be formed at the electrode, mainly on an anode. This layer is sensitive to many different factors and has major impacts on battery performance during its life time. Battery formation can take many days depending on the battery chemistry. Using a 0.1 C (C is the cell capacity) current during formation is very typical, taking up to 20 hours for a full charge and discharge cycle, making up 20% to 30% of the total battery cost.
